Sweet Stampin wk 4








This week over at Sweet Stampin we were set a colour challenge usint the colurs brilliant Blue, Bashful Blue, Old olive and More Mustard.

For my card I used Bashful Blue brayered along the bottom of my cardstock and a thin strip of old olive to adorn Brilliant Blue buttons die cut from my Sizzix. Using stamp set Toy Box I stamped onto white cardstock using Brilliant Blue and coloured the yachts star n stripes in Old olive directly from the ink pad using a watercolour brush. I cut my square mounts using nestabilities in Old Olive and Blue and mounted my images. I then used Toy box Star stamp and stamped the 3rd white cardstock mount using Bashful Blue and Sentiment to compliment in Old Olive.
Inks used were Bashful Blue, Old Olive , Brilliant Blue.
Stamp set used Toy Box from SU.

Simple layout cards really do test me as Im so used to layering lots of different papers, but I think I'm happy with this result.
